At Springpoint, our Director of Social Services primary purpose is to provide medically-related social services to attain or maintain the highest practicable physical, mental and psychosocial wellbeing of each resident. “Medically-related social services” means services provided to assist residents in maintaining their ability to manage their everyday physical, mental and psychosocial needs.

Responsibilities

Develop and implement case management services to all residents

Make arrangements for obtaining needed adaptive equipment, clothing and personal items

Maintain contact with family (with resident’s permission) to report on changes in health, current goals, discharge planning and encouragement to participate in care planning

Maintain progress notes under federal and state guidelines for Long Term Care

Assist staff to inform residents and those they designate about the residents’ health status and health care choices and their ramifications.

Make referrals and obtain services from outside entities (e.g. talking books, absentee ballots, community wheelchair transportation)

Assist residents with financial and legal matters (e.g. applying for pension, Medicaid, referrals to lawyer, obtaining Power of Attorney, legal guardianship procedures, trustee)

Discharge planning services (e.g. facilitates transfers to other facilities, helping to place resident on a waiting list for community services, arranging intake for home care services for residents returning home, arranging for home care).

Arranging for provision of needed counseling services

Through the assessment and care planning process, identify and seek ways to support resident’s individual needs and preferences, customary routines, concerns and choices

Facilitate the building of relationships between residents and staff by teaching staff how to understand and support residents’ individual needs.

Facilitate family and resident support groups
